> Hello,
>
> we use a ARM custom Board with mysqld. Shuting down mysqld (with IAO support,
> on a ext3 formatted Harddrive) leads to a negative number of dirty pages
> (underrun to the counter). The negative number results in a drastic reduction
> of the write performance because the page cache is not used, because the kernel
> thinks it is still 2 ^ 32 dirty pages open. I found, the problem is
> mm/truncate.c->cancel_dirty_page()
>
> To reproduce,first change cancel_dirty_page()
>
> [...]
> if (mapping && mapping_cap_account_dirty (mapping)) {
> ++WARN_ON ((int) global_page_state(NR_FILE_DIRTY) <0);
> dec_zone_page_state (page, NR_FILE_DIRTY);
> [...]
>
> And test ->
hm, I wonder what AIO is doing differently - cancel_dirty_page() isn't
specific to aio - it's used by all truncations.
Just to sanity check, could you please try something like this?
--- a/include/linux/vmstat.h~a
+++ a/include/linux/vmstat.h
@@ -241,6 +241,8 @@ static inline void __inc_zone_state(stru
static inline void __dec_zone_state(struct zone *zone, enum zone_stat_item item)
{
atomic_long_dec(&zone->vm_stat[item]);
+ WARN_ON_ONCE(item == NR_FILE_DIRTY &&
+ atomic_long_read(&zone->vm_stat[item]) < 0);
atomic_long_dec(&vm_stat[item]);
}
That should catch the first offending decrement, although yes, it's
probably cancel_dirty_page().
(This assumes you're using an SMP kernel. If not,
mm/vmstat.c:dec_zone_page_state() will need to be changed instead)
